The price of cooking oil has increased by 25%.By what percent should a family reduce the consumption of cooking oil so as not to increase the expenditure in this account?20%25%18%16%
Solution
To solve this problem, we need to find the percentage decrease in consumption that would offset the 25% increase in price.
Here are the steps:
-
Let's assume the original price of the cooking oil is 1.
-
After the price increase by 25%, the new price becomes $1.25 per unit.
-
To keep the expenditure the same (1 / $1.25 = 0.8 units.
-
This means the family should now consume 0.8 units of cooking oil to keep the expenditure the same.
-
To find the percentage decrease in consumption, we subtract the new consumption from the original consumption, divide by the original consumption, and then multiply by 100%: ((1 - 0.8) / 1) * 100% = 20%.
So, the family should reduce their consumption of cooking oil by 20% to avoid an increase in expenditure.
